"Damn! Jury Summons?!" is a game where you you play as a demon lawyer trying to send the defendant to hell.

How to play: - You are the demon on the left. Above your head is your energy. - When you have enough energy, you can use abilities. These abilities are at the bottom of the screen. Some require you to have a target. - Select a Juror by clicking on them, and your abilities will target them. - Move the bars above the Juror's heads to the left by the end of the time limit. If enough Jurors are on your side, you win.
